Path Lines of Code src/Editor/Text/Impl/BraceCompletion/AssemblyInfo.cs 14 src/Editor/Text/Impl/BraceCompletion/BraceCompletionAdornmentService.cs 157 src/Editor/Text/Impl/BraceCompletion/BraceCompletionAdornmentServiceFactory.cs 25 src/Editor/Text/Impl/BraceCompletion/BraceCompletionAggregator.cs 312 src/Editor/Text/Impl/BraceCompletion/BraceCompletionAggregatorFactory.cs 59 src/Editor/Text/Impl/BraceCompletion/BraceCompletionCommandHandler.cs 144 src/Editor/Text/Impl/BraceCompletion/BraceCompletionDefaultSession.cs 308 src/Editor/Text/Impl/BraceCompletion/BraceCompletionEnabledOption.cs 14 src/Editor/Text/Impl/BraceCompletion/BraceCompletionFormat.cs 23 src/Editor/Text/Impl/BraceCompletion/BraceCompletionManager.cs 384 src/Editor/Text/Impl/BraceCompletion/BraceCompletionManagerFactory.cs 31 src/Editor/Text/Impl/BraceCompletion/BraceCompletionStack.cs 243 src/Editor/Text/Impl/BraceCompletion/IBraceCompletionAdornmentService.cs 9 src/Editor/Text/Impl/BraceCompletion/IBraceCompletionAdornmentServiceFactory.cs 9 src/Editor/Text/Impl/BraceCompletion/IBraceCompletionAggregator.cs 13 src/Editor/Text/Impl/BraceCompletion/IBraceCompletionAggregatorFactory.cs 13 src/Editor/Text/Impl/BraceCompletion/IBraceCompletionMetadata.cs 11 src/Editor/Text/Impl/BraceCompletion/IBraceCompletionStack.cs 15 src/Editor/Text/Impl/BraceCompletion/PlainTextDefaults.cs 15 src/Editor/Text/Impl/ClassificationAggregator/AssemblyInfo.cs 14 src/Editor/Text/Impl/ClassificationAggregator/ClassifierAggregator.cs 256 src/Editor/Text/Impl/ClassificationAggregator/ClassifierAggregatorService.cs 26 src/Editor/Text/Impl/ClassificationAggregator/ClassifierTagger.cs 76 src/Editor/Text/Impl/ClassificationAggregator/ClassifierTaggerProvider.cs 31 src/Editor/Text/Impl/ClassificationAggregator/ProjectionWorkaround.cs 69 src/Editor/Text/Impl/ClassificationType/AssemblyInfo.cs 13 src/Editor/Text/Impl/ClassificationType/ClassificationKey.cs 35 src/Editor/Text/Impl/ClassificationType/ClassificationTypeImpl.cs 52 src/Editor/Text/Impl/ClassificationType/ClassificationTypeRegistryService.cs 171 src/Editor/Text/Impl/Commanding/AssemblyInfo.cs 14 src/Editor/Text/Impl/Commanding/CommandHandlerBucket.cs 32 src/Editor/Text/Impl/Commanding/DefaultBufferResolver.cs 48 src/Editor/Text/Impl/Commanding/EditorCommandHandlerService.cs 411 src/Editor/Text/Impl/Commanding/EditorCommandHandlerServiceFactory.cs 75 src/Editor/Text/Impl/Commanding/EditorCommandHandlerServiceState.cs 47 src/Editor/Text/Impl/Commanding/ICommandHandlerMetadata.cs 11 src/Editor/Text/Impl/Commanding/SingleBufferResolver.cs 24 src/Editor/Text/Impl/DifferenceAlgorithm/AssemblyInfo.cs 16 src/Editor/Text/Impl/DifferenceAlgorithm/CharacterDecompositionList.cs 103 src/Editor/Text/Impl/DifferenceAlgorithm/DefaultTextDifferencingService.cs 122 src/Editor/Text/Impl/DifferenceAlgorithm/DiffChangeCollectionHelper.cs 39 src/Editor/Text/Impl/DifferenceAlgorithm/HierarchicalDifferenceCollection.cs 105 src/Editor/Text/Impl/DifferenceAlgorithm/LineDecompositionList.cs 66 src/Editor/Text/Impl/DifferenceAlgorithm/MaximalSubsequenceAlgorithm.cs 54 src/Editor/Text/Impl/DifferenceAlgorithm/SnapshotLineList.cs 159 src/Editor/Text/Impl/DifferenceAlgorithm/TFS/DiffFinder.cs 488 src/Editor/Text/Impl/DifferenceAlgorithm/TFS/LCSDiff.cs 499 src/Editor/Text/Impl/DifferenceAlgorithm/TextDifferencingSelectorService.cs 33 src/Editor/Text/Impl/DifferenceAlgorithm/TokenizedStringList.cs 146 src/Editor/Text/Impl/DifferenceAlgorithm/WordDecompositionList.cs 103 src/Editor/Text/Impl/EditorOperations/AfterTextBufferChangeUndoPrimitive.cs 74 src/Editor/Text/Impl/EditorOperations/AssemblyInfo.cs 13 src/Editor/Text/Impl/EditorOperations/BeforeTextBufferChangeUndoPrimitive.cs 83 src/Editor/Text/Impl/EditorOperations/CollapsedMoveUndoPrimitive.cs 145 src/Editor/Text/Impl/EditorOperations/Commands/DuplicateSelectionCommandHandler.cs 27 src/Editor/Text/Impl/EditorOperations/Commands/NavigateToNextIssueCommandHandler.cs 140 src/Editor/Text/Impl/EditorOperations/EditorOperations.cs 3764 src/Editor/Text/Impl/EditorOperations/EditorOperationsFactoryService.cs 57 src/Editor/Text/Impl/EditorOperations/TextEditAction.cs 15 src/Editor/Text/Impl/EditorOperations/TextTransactionMergePolicy.cs 101 src/Editor/Text/Impl/EditorOptions/AssemblyInfo.cs 14 src/Editor/Text/Impl/EditorOptions/EditorOptions.cs 265 src/Editor/Text/Impl/EditorOptions/EditorOptionsFactoryService.cs 161 src/Editor/Text/Impl/EditorOptions/TextModelEditorOptions.cs 54 src/Editor/Text/Impl/EditorOptions/TextModelOptionsSetter.cs 17 src/Editor/Text/Impl/EditorPrimitives/AssemblyInfo.cs 14 src/Editor/Text/Impl/EditorPrimitives/BufferPrimitives.cs 20 src/Editor/Text/Impl/EditorPrimitives/DefaultBufferPrimitive.cs 105 src/Editor/Text/Impl/EditorPrimitives/DefaultBufferPrimitivesFactoryService.cs 44 src/Editor/Text/Impl/EditorPrimitives/DefaultCaretPrimitive.cs 780 src/Editor/Text/Impl/EditorPrimitives/DefaultDisplayTextPointPrimitive.cs 384 src/Editor/Text/Impl/EditorPrimitives/DefaultDisplayTextRangePrimitive.cs 174 src/Editor/Text/Impl/EditorPrimitives/DefaultSelectionPrimitive.cs 391 src/Editor/Text/Impl/EditorPrimitives/DefaultTextPointPrimitive.cs 766 src/Editor/Text/Impl/EditorPrimitives/DefaultTextRangePrimitive.cs 319 src/Editor/Text/Impl/EditorPrimitives/DefaultTextViewPrimitive.cs 127 src/Editor/Text/Impl/EditorPrimitives/DefaultViewPrimitivesFactoryService.cs 50 src/Editor/Text/Impl/EditorPrimitives/EditorPrimitivesFactoryService.cs 25 src/Editor/Text/Impl/EditorPrimitives/FxCopSupressions.cs 38 src/Editor/Text/Impl/EditorPrimitives/PrimitivesUtilities.cs 59 src/Editor/Text/Impl/EditorPrimitives/ViewPrimitives.cs 36 src/Editor/Text/Impl/Navigation/AssemblyInfo.cs 14 src/Editor/Text/Impl/Navigation/DefaultTextNavigator.cs 90 src/Editor/Text/Impl/Navigation/TextStructureNavigatorSelectorService.cs 68 src/Editor/Text/Impl/Outlining/AssemblyInfo.cs 14 src/Editor/Text/Impl/Outlining/Collapsible.cs 74 src/Editor/Text/Impl/Outlining/OutliningCommandHandler.cs 349 src/Editor/Text/Impl/Outlining/OutliningManager.cs 555 src/Editor/Text/Impl/Outlining/OutliningManagerService.cs 39 src/Editor/Text/Impl/PatternMatching/AllLowerCamelCaseMatcher.cs 160 src/Editor/Text/Impl/PatternMatching/ArraySlice.cs 67 src/Editor/Text/Impl/PatternMatching/AssemblyInfo.cs 14 src/Editor/Text/Impl/PatternMatching/CamelCaseResult.cs 64 src/Editor/Text/Impl/PatternMatching/CaseInsensitiveComparison.cs 43 src/Editor/Text/Impl/PatternMatching/ContainerPatternMatcher.cs 86 src/Editor/Text/Impl/PatternMatching/EditDistance.cs 273 src/Editor/Text/Impl/PatternMatching/PatternMatchExtensions.cs 85 src/Editor/Text/Impl/PatternMatching/PatternMatchMergeStrategy.cs 13 src/Editor/Text/Impl/PatternMatching/PatternMatcher.PatternSegment.cs 88 src/Editor/Text/Impl/PatternMatching/PatternMatcher.TextChunk.cs 27 src/Editor/Text/Impl/PatternMatching/PatternMatcher.cs 415 src/Editor/Text/Impl/PatternMatching/PatternMatcherFactory.cs 50 src/Editor/Text/Impl/PatternMatching/SimplePatternMatcher.cs 46 src/Editor/Text/Impl/PatternMatching/StringBreaker.cs 216 src/Editor/Text/Impl/PatternMatching/StringBreaks.EncodedSpans.cs 27 src/Editor/Text/Impl/PatternMatching/Utilities.cs 29 src/Editor/Text/Impl/PatternMatching/WordSimilarityChecker.cs 133 src/Editor/Text/Impl/StandaloneUndo/AssemblyInfo.cs 14 src/Editor/Text/Impl/StandaloneUndo/AutoEnclose.cs 20 src/Editor/Text/Impl/StandaloneUndo/CatchOperationsFromHistoryForDelegatedPrimitive.cs 24 src/Editor/Text/Impl/StandaloneUndo/DelegatedUndoPrimitiveImpl.cs 89 src/Editor/Text/Impl/StandaloneUndo/DelegatedUndoPrimitiveState.cs 9 src/Editor/Text/Impl/StandaloneUndo/NullMergeUndoTransactionPolicy.cs 36 src/Editor/Text/Impl/StandaloneUndo/UndoHistoryImpl.cs 362 src/Editor/Text/Impl/StandaloneUndo/UndoHistoryRegistryImpl.cs 189 src/Editor/Text/Impl/StandaloneUndo/UndoTransactionImpl.cs 271 src/Editor/Text/Impl/StandaloneUndo/UndoableOperationCurried.cs 4 src/Editor/Text/Impl/StandaloneUndo/WeakReferenceForDictionaryKey.cs 65 src/Editor/Text/Impl/TagAggregator/AssemblyInfo.cs 15 src/Editor/Text/Impl/TagAggregator/IViewTaggerMetadata.cs 11 src/Editor/Text/Impl/TagAggregator/TagAggregator.cs 630 src/Editor/Text/Impl/TagAggregator/TagAggregatorFactoryService.cs 120 src/Editor/Text/Impl/TextBufferUndoManager/AssemblyInfo.cs 13 src/Editor/Text/Impl/TextBufferUndoManager/TextBufferChangeUndoPrimitive.cs 195 src/Editor/Text/Impl/TextBufferUndoManager/TextBufferUndoManager.cs 169 src/Editor/Text/Impl/TextBufferUndoManager/TextBufferUndoManagerProvider.cs 51 src/Editor/Text/Impl/TextModel/AssemblyInfo.cs 11 src/Editor/Text/Impl/TextModel/BaseBuffer.cs 908 src/Editor/Text/Impl/TextModel/BaseSnapshot.cs 161 src/Editor/Text/Impl/TextModel/BufferFactoryService.cs 340 src/Editor/Text/Impl/TextModel/BufferGroup.cs 538 src/Editor/Text/Impl/TextModel/CachingTextImage.cs 70 src/Editor/Text/Impl/TextModel/EncodedStreamReader.cs 77 src/Editor/Text/Impl/TextModel/ExtendedCharacterDetectionDecoder.cs 38 src/Editor/Text/Impl/TextModel/ExtendedCharacterDetector.cs 22 src/Editor/Text/Impl/TextModel/FallbackDetector.cs 54 src/Editor/Text/Impl/TextModel/FileNameKey.cs 36 src/Editor/Text/Impl/TextModel/FileUtilities.cs 191 src/Editor/Text/Impl/TextModel/ForwardFidelityCustomTrackingSpan.cs 27 src/Editor/Text/Impl/TextModel/ForwardFidelityTrackingPoint.cs 63 src/Editor/Text/Impl/TextModel/ForwardFidelityTrackingSpan.cs 73 src/Editor/Text/Impl/TextModel/HighFidelityTrackingPoint.cs 313 src/Editor/Text/Impl/TextModel/HighFidelityTrackingSpan.cs 134 src/Editor/Text/Impl/TextModel/IInternalTextBufferFactory.cs 13 src/Editor/Text/Impl/TextModel/ISubordinateTextEdit.cs 14 src/Editor/Text/Impl/TextModel/LineBreakBoundaryConditions.cs 11 src/Editor/Text/Impl/TextModel/MappingPoint.cs 128 src/Editor/Text/Impl/TextModel/MappingSpan.cs 138 src/Editor/Text/Impl/TextModel/NativeMethods.cs 33 src/Editor/Text/Impl/TextModel/NormalizedTextChangeCollection.cs 369 src/Editor/Text/Impl/TextModel/PersistentSpan.cs 199 src/Editor/Text/Impl/TextModel/PersistentSpanFactory.cs 164 src/Editor/Text/Impl/TextModel/PersistentSpanSet.cs 99 src/Editor/Text/Impl/TextModel/Projection/BaseProjectionBuffer.cs 191 src/Editor/Text/Impl/TextModel/Projection/BaseProjectionSnapshot.cs 43 src/Editor/Text/Impl/TextModel/Projection/BufferGraph.cs 674 src/Editor/Text/Impl/TextModel/Projection/BufferGraphFactoryService.cs 20 src/Editor/Text/Impl/TextModel/Projection/ElisionBuffer.cs 398 src/Editor/Text/Impl/TextModel/Projection/ElisionMap.cs 273 src/Editor/Text/Impl/TextModel/Projection/ElisionMapNode.cs 910 src/Editor/Text/Impl/TextModel/Projection/ElisionSnapshot.cs 221 src/Editor/Text/Impl/TextModel/Projection/ProjectionBuffer.cs 1513 src/Editor/Text/Impl/TextModel/Projection/ProjectionSnapshot.cs 597 src/Editor/Text/Impl/TextModel/Projection/ProjectionSpanToChangeConverter.cs 69 src/Editor/Text/Impl/TextModel/Projection/ProjectionUtilities.cs 19 src/Editor/Text/Impl/TextModel/Projection/WeakEventHook.cs 71 src/Editor/Text/Impl/TextModel/ReadOnlyRegion.cs 39 src/Editor/Text/Impl/TextModel/ReadOnlySpan.cs 79 src/Editor/Text/Impl/TextModel/ReadOnlySpanCollection.cs 190 src/Editor/Text/Impl/TextModel/Storage/CharStream.cs 107 src/Editor/Text/Impl/TextModel/Storage/Compressor.cs 66 src/Editor/Text/Impl/TextModel/Storage/ILineBreaks.cs 20 src/Editor/Text/Impl/TextModel/Storage/LineBreakManager.cs 160 src/Editor/Text/Impl/TextModel/Storage/Page.cs 31 src/Editor/Text/Impl/TextModel/Storage/PageManager.cs 48 src/Editor/Text/Impl/TextModel/Storage/TextImageLoader.cs 181 src/Editor/Text/Impl/TextModel/StringRebuilder/BinaryStringRebuilder.cs 273 src/Editor/Text/Impl/TextModel/StringRebuilder/StringRebuilder.cs 183 src/Editor/Text/Impl/TextModel/StringRebuilder/StringRebuilderForChars.cs 70 src/Editor/Text/Impl/TextModel/StringRebuilder/StringRebuilderForCompressedChars.cs 62 src/Editor/Text/Impl/TextModel/StringRebuilder/StringRebuilderForString.cs 89 src/Editor/Text/Impl/TextModel/StringRebuilder/UnaryStringRebuilder.cs 139 src/Editor/Text/Impl/TextModel/TextBuffer.cs 223 src/Editor/Text/Impl/TextModel/TextChange.cs 265 src/Editor/Text/Impl/TextModel/TextDocument.cs 436 src/Editor/Text/Impl/TextModel/TextDocumentFactoryService.cs 260 src/Editor/Text/Impl/TextModel/TextImageVersion.cs 86 src/Editor/Text/Impl/TextModel/TextModelUtilities.cs 48 src/Editor/Text/Impl/TextModel/TextSnapshot.cs 23 src/Editor/Text/Impl/TextModel/TextSnapshotLine.cs 84 src/Editor/Text/Impl/TextModel/TextVersion.cs 132 src/Editor/Text/Impl/TextModel/TrackingPoint.cs 79 src/Editor/Text/Impl/TextModel/TrackingSpan.cs 100 src/Editor/Text/Impl/TextModel/TrivialNormalizedTextChangeCollection.cs 186 src/Editor/Text/Impl/TextModel/VersionNumberPosition.cs 22 src/Editor/Text/Impl/TextModel/WhitespaceManager.cs 96 src/Editor/Text/Impl/TextModel/WhitespaceManagerFactory.cs 28 src/Editor/Text/Impl/TextSearch/AssemblyInfo.cs 13 src/Editor/Text/Impl/TextSearch/TextSearchNavigator.cs 411 src/Editor/Text/Impl/TextSearch/TextSearchNavigatorFactoryService.cs 24 src/Editor/Text/Impl/TextSearch/TextSearchService.cs 507 src/Editor/Text/Impl/XPlat/MultiCaretImpl/AssemblyInfo.cs 17 src/Editor/Text/Impl/XPlat/MultiCaretImpl/DelegateDisposable.cs 18 src/Editor/Text/Impl/XPlat/MultiCaretImpl/MultiSelectionBroker.cs 652 src/Editor/Text/Impl/XPlat/MultiCaretImpl/MultiSelectionBrokerFactory.cs 31 src/Editor/Text/Impl/XPlat/MultiCaretImpl/MultiSelectionCommandHandler.cs 304 src/Editor/Text/Impl/XPlat/MultiCaretImpl/SelectionTransformer.cs 730 src/Editor/Text/Impl/XPlat/MultiCaretImpl/SelectionUIProperties.cs 142